UDMR leader Kelemen Gunor delivered a message on Sunday for Hungary’s National Unity Day, acknowledging that living in a community and keeping it strong is no easy task. “We cannot rewrite the past and we don’t want to,” the Hungarian leader said, adding that we are all responsible for the future, News.ro reports.

“Living in a community and keeping that community strong is not an easy task. However, for us it is as natural as breathing: speaking Hungarian in our family and among friends, sending our children to schools with Hungarian education, reading in Hungarian and consuming Hungarian culture are part of our daily lives,” Kelemen Hunor wrote on Facebook on Sunday .

According to him, June 4, the Day of National Unity of Hungary, is a day to celebrate these ordinary, but still important events.

“Let’s be proud of ourselves, our community and our identity. We cannot rewrite the past and we do not want to. But we are all responsible for the future, for our future,” added Kelemen Hunor.
